Another great start to 2016! Netflix has just announced the global launch of their internet TV service. The service is now live in more than 130 new countries around the world, including the Philippines. The big surprise was unveiled during the keynote of Netflix Co-founder and Chief Executive Reed Hastings in CES 2016.
